Output 66139db76cadfe7a3edf6fe5c0e20802b94274e9696fb20c08c52f28b27ad498:1

value
1375290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45147ea32417bedf5d4ab0ac2655da8ecd588452 OP_EQUAL
address
37zH6muuMhA9ard9xB6pTXz8UfYaabBJ7C
transaction
66139db76cadfe7a3edf6fe5c0e20802b94274e9696fb20c08c52f28b27ad498
spent
true